Santos Port: Santos Port is the busiest port in Brazil and the largest in South America. It handles a wide range of cargo, including containers, liquid bulk, dry bulk, and general cargo. The port is strategically located near the city of Sao Paulo, making it a major hub for trade in the region.
Rio de Janeiro Port: Rio de Janeiro Port is an important port in Brazil, handling various types of cargo such as containers, dry bulk, and liquid bulk. It is a key gateway for trade in the southeastern region of the country and plays a crucial role in the country's economy.
Paranagua Port: Paranagua Port is a major port in southern Brazil, specializing in grain exports. It is one of the largest grain export ports in the country, handling a significant portion of Brazil's agricultural products. The port also handles containers, general cargo, and liquid bulk.
Itajai Port: Itajai Port is a key container port in Brazil, located in the state of Santa Catarina. It is one of the busiest ports in the country for container traffic, serving as an important gateway for trade in the region. The port has modern infrastructure and facilities to handle a high volume of containers.
Rio Grande Port: Rio Grande Port is a major port in southern Brazil, specializing in container and bulk cargo. It is one of the largest ports in the country in terms of cargo throughput and plays a crucial role in the region's economy. The port has modern facilities and equipment to handle a wide range of cargo efficiently.

Bissau Port: Bissau Port is the largest and busiest port in Guinea-Bissau. It serves as the primary gateway for imports and exports in the country. The port has facilities for handling a wide range of cargo including containers, bulk cargo, and general cargo. Bissau Port plays a crucial role in the country's economy by facilitating trade and commerce.
Bolama Port: Bolama Port is located on Bolama Island and is an important port for the region. It serves as a key transportation hub for the surrounding areas, handling both commercial and passenger traffic. The port has facilities for loading and unloading cargo, as well as facilities for ferry services to nearby islands.
Bubaque Port: Bubaque Port is a small port located on Bubaque Island. It primarily serves the local community and is a key hub for fishing activities in the region. The port also supports some small-scale commercial activities, but its main focus is on supporting the local economy through fishing and related activities.
Cacheu Port: Cacheu Port is located in the town of Cacheu and serves as a major port for the northern region of Guinea-Bissau. The port primarily handles general cargo and agricultural products, including cashew nuts which are a key export for the country. Cacheu Port plays an important role in facilitating trade and commerce in the region.
Other ports in Guinea-Bissau include Farim Port and Geba Port. These ports are smaller in size and primarily serve the local communities in their respective regions. Farim Port supports agricultural activities in the Farim area, while Geba Port is a key hub for fishing activities in the Geba River region.

For container transportation from Brazil to Guinea-Bissau, various factors come into play. The size of the shipping container, the type of goods to be shipped, distance of the destination, and the shipping method (either Full Container Load or Less than Container Load) all directly affect the cost.
On average, shipping cargo from Brazil to Guinea-Bissau via sea freight can take approximately 20-30 days. The transit time can vary depending on factors such as distance between the two countries, shipping route, weather conditions, port congestion, and the efficiency of logistics processes. The distance between Brazil and Guinea-Bissau is considerable, which contributes to the longer transit time. Additionally, customs clearance procedures and documentation requirements in both countries can also impact the overall shipping duration.
